I have asterisk 1.6.2.10 and whenever there are more than 60 calls queued
the following problem ocurrs.
The agents hangup the calls but the do not receive new calls for some
seconds or even minutes.

If I seek throughout the full log I encounter that the Bye message coming
from asterisk to the agents failes to arrive.
If I make calls between extensions what I see is the following:

Extension A calls extension B.
Extension A hangups.
Bye message is send from extension A to asterisk.
Asterisk sends an Ok message to extension A.
After some seconds or even minutes, extension B receives Bye message from
asterisk.
